Registro de Facebook vinculado a la base de datos MySQL

Soy relativamente nuevo en la programación de sitios web y cualquier consejo o ayuda es muy apreciado.

He diseñado un sitio de golf para mi región en el Reino Unido y me gustaría implementar Inicio de sesión / Registro para facilitar el acceso y las inscripciones. He revisado el sitio web de desarrolladores de Facebook un par de veces, pero se me pasa un poco la cabeza.

Tengo el botón de inicio de sesión bien, pero para el registro me gustaría acceder a la información de los usuarios en una base de datos [etiqueta: MySQL}. ¿Alguien sabe como hacer esto? He establecido parámetros en la base de datos que son:

  • id
  • fb_id
  • nombre
  • email
  • género
  • cumpleaños
  • ubicación

Sin embargo, dice: -

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'near) NOT NULL, `birthday` DATE NOT NULL, `location` VARCHAR(255) NOT NULL, UNIQ' at line 1 

¿Cómo puedo solucionar el problema y luego hacer que mi inicio de sesión de registro se redirija a MySQL?

Básicamente, me gustaría un perfil separado para cada usuario que pueda compartir estadísticas de golf, organizar juegos con amigos y publicar puntajes recientes.

Déjeme saber sus pensamientos y cualquier consejo es bienvenido.

Gracias, darren

preguntado el 16 de mayo de 11 a las 20:05

danos el SQL. tiene el error, no sus columnas. -

1 Respuestas

Está intentando acceder a los datos de Facebook con MySQL, lo cual no es posible. En su lugar, intente utilizar las API nativas de conexión de Facebook.

contestado el 17 de mayo de 11 a las 00:05

Gracias por la respuesta. Entonces, básicamente, ¿tengo que usar el código de Facebook proporcionado en su sitio web de desarrollador? Sería genial si tuviera su propio código de ejemplo. - Darren Head

No es la respuesta que estás buscando? Examinar otras preguntas etiquetadas or haz tu propia pregunta.